Ikon El Jefe
This was never intended to be an adjustable but there is a flaw in the design/casting of the head and an unintended consequence of it turned it into an adjustable. The posts that locate the blade are too thin and as a result the blade can be pushed a little forward for an agressive shave or pulled back for a mild shave. There is also movement in the topcap which also contributes a little. (See the fourth image below) So you have Blade Forward/Back and TopCap Forward/Back. The various permutations on them will give you 4 settings Its not a true adjustable, you select the setting and then shave with it with no changes during the shave. It only had one run and then was taken off the market once people started complaining. They were sold wothout handles. It still needs its own handle. Currently, I'm undecided on design and length.

How does it shave? It goes from Mild to Wild. It uses Artist Club blades, so there are some choices there. If I use it on its most aggressive with a "Professional" blade and I find it very aggressive. On ots least aggressive its mild yet pretty effecient. |
